Output c86e672d230b31321b364ef13319a5830394d3fccd66d260752c44e3ae56bd1f:2

value
68976
script pubkey
OP_0 OP_PUSHBYTES_20 021dd3e6956be4a0e560f296ade02c70f56fee00
address
bc1qqgwa8e54d0j2petq72t2mcpvwr6klmsqyyge4y
transaction
c86e672d230b31321b364ef13319a5830394d3fccd66d260752c44e3ae56bd1f
confirmations
251973
spent
true